But prayer... (Acts 12:5).
But prayer is the link that connects us with God. This is the
bridge that spans every gulf and bears me over every abyss of danger or of need.
How significant the picture of the Apostolic Church: Peter in
prison, the Jews triumphant Herod supreme the arena of martyrdom awaiting the dawning of the morning to drink up the apostle's
blood, and everything else against it "But prayer was made unto God without ceasing. " And what was the sequel? The prison open, the
apostle free, the Jews baffled, the wicked king eaten of worms, a spectacle of hidden retribution, and the Word of God rolling on in greater victory.
Do we know the power of our supernatural weapon? Do we dare to use it with the authority of a faith that commands as well as asks? God
baptize us with holy audacity and Divine confidence! He Is not
wanting great men, but He is wanting men who win dare to prove the
greatness of their God. But God! But prayer! --A. B. Simpson.
Beware In your prayer, above everything, of limiting God, not only by unbelief, but by fancying that you know what He can do. Expect unexpected things, above all that we ask or think. Each time you
intercede, be quiet first and worship God in His glory. Think of
what He can do, of how He delights to hear Christ, of your place in Christ, and expect great things. --Andrew Murray.
Our prayers are God's opportunities.
Are you in son-ow? Prayer can make your affliction sweet and
strengthening. Are you in gladness? Prayer can add to your joy a
celestial perfume. Are you in extreme danger from outward or Inward enemies? Prayer can set at your right hand an angel whose touch
could shatter a millstone into smaller dust than the flour it
grinds, and whose glance could lay an army low. What will prayer do for you? I answer: All that God can do for you. "Ask what I shall
give thee." --Farrar.
Wrestling prayer can wonders do, Bring relief in deepest straits;
Prayer can force a passage through Iron bars and brazen gates.
